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ar...

24
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S

Transcript of 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ar...

Page 1: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

INTRODUCCIÓN Y CONCEPTOS

Page 2: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

OBJETIVO

• Integrar información aislada en archivos o sistemas, tanto corporativos como de usuarios individuales.

• Migrar información rápidamente de un sistema a otro.

• Ajustar y transformar información.

• Garantizar integridad de la informacion (validación) a nivel de:– Proceso (Ej: control en la frecuencia del envío)

– Técnico (Ej: número de .mensajes enviados vs. recibidos)

– Funcional (Ej: comparación de la información origen vs. destino)

Page 3: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

PROBLEMÁTICA ACTUAL

• Cambios en las fuentes de información generan el 60% de los costos de mantenimiento.

• Información contenida en MÚLTIPLES FORMATOS NO ESTANDAR por usuarios individuales.

• Información INCOMPATIBLE con esquemas de bases de datos relacionales.

• Información generalmente contenida o exportable a HOJAS DE CÁLCULO (generalmente MS-EXCEL).

• Usuarios reacios al cambio pero conformes con su herramienta habitual de trabajo (por lo general MS Excel).

• Tiempos críticos de adaptabilidad

Page 4: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

NECESIDADES Y REQUERIMIENTOS

• Capturar Información– Consultas SQL a bases de datos– Hojas Excel– Archivos planos separados por comas o tabuladores– Archivos o mensajes en XML

• Transformar información– Ajustar en el origen– Homologar informacion– Formatear información

• Cargar Información en forma transparente al usuario vía:– FTP (File transfer protocol)– HTTP (Hypertext transfer protocol)– Ejecución de scripts dinámicos en bases de datos– Soporte XML, archivos planos, mensajería.

• Verificar/Comparar información vía reportes de control, inconsistencias y errores.

Page 5: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

SOLUCIÓN: ANALITICA INTEGRATOR

Page 6: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

¿ QUE ES ANALYTICAL INTEGRATOR ?

Solución ETL para– captura– transformación– e inserción en sistemas de informacion,

de datos provenientes de:– hojas de Excel– archivos planos– mensajes y archivos XML– bases de datos relacionales

Page 7: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

MODELO GENERAL: ANALYTICAL INTEGRATOR

Page 8: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

MODELO OPERATIVO: ANALYTICAL INTEGRATOR

Page 9: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

MODELO FUNCIONAL: ANALYTICAL INTEGRATOR

Page 10: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

CAPTURA / EXTRACCIÓN DE DATOS

• Bases de datos relacionales– ODBC– ADO

• Archivos– Excel– Txt– CSV– XML

• Otras aplicaciones (vía complementos/plug-ins de Excel)

Page 11: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

FILTRADO Y AJUSTE DE INFORMACIÓN

• Omisión de filas o columnas no deseadas• Transposición de tablas cruzadas• Agregación y desagregación de información• Manipulación vía funciones de MS-EXCEL sobre datos cargados.• Control de información incompleta vía:

– Valores/Funciones predeterminados– Omisión de parcial o total de registros

• Inferencia de informacion basada en los datos existentes.• Generación de valores constantes adicionales.• Adaptabilidad a cambios en estructuras de informacion (Caso

MS-Excel) via:– Ordenamiento de la información– Eliminación y adición de filas o columnas

Page 12: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

TRADUCCIÓN – HOMOLOGACIÓN DE INFORMACION

• Tablas de mapeo centralizadas– En una base de datos

• Tablas de mapeo distribuidas– Hojas Excel– Archivos Planos– Archivos XML

Page 13: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

TRANSFORMACIÓN A FORMATO DEFINITIVO

• Generación de archivos:– Planos (txt o csv)– XML (según estructura predeterminada)

• Generación de código dinámico (scripts)– SQL– XSLT– HTML

Page 14: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

SEGMENTACIÓN

• Generación de archivos o mensajes individuales vía segmentación de bloques de información, para facilitar los procesos de carga.

Page 15: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

CARGA DE INFORMACIÓN

• Envió de información vía:– FTP– HTTP– SOAP / Web-Servicies

• Ejecución de Scripts– Oracle – PL/SQL– Sybase / SQL Server – TransacSQL– MySQL

• Control de envío– Mensajes o archivos enviados– Reporte de errores de carga– Tiempos de envío

Page 16: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

CONTROL DE INTEGRIDAD

Page 17: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

CONTROL DE INTEGRIDAD

Page 18: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

INTEGRIDAD TÉCNICA

Page 19: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

INTEGRIDAD FUNCIONAL

Page 20: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

MODELO TÉCNICO: ANALYTICAL INTEGRATOR

Page 21: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

PROCESO DE IMPLEMENTACIÓN

Page 22: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

ESTRATEGIA DE IMPLEMENTACIÓN

Equipos de trabajo paralelos en cada frente de integración.

Page 23: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

VENTAJAS DE LA HERRAMIENTA

• OPERATIVAS– Procesamiento centralizado y/o distribuido– Procesamiento por lotes o en tiempo real

• FUNCIONALES– Soporte a múltiples sistemas origen y destino– Transformaciones predefinidas– Filtros de información– Integración con Excel

• DESARROLLO E IMPLANTACIÓN– Un solo ambiente de desarrollo– Escalabilidad a nivel de múltiples desarrolladores– Tiempos mínimos de entrenamiento– Esquema de configuración que minimiza la programación– Herramientas de depuración– Independencia entre el diseño y la implementación– Manejo de estándares de la industria– Control de integridad

Page 24: ANALITICA - INTEGRATOR INTRODUCCIÓN Y CONCEPTOS. ANALITICA - INTEGRATOR OBJETIVO Integrar información aislada en archivos o sistemas, tanto corporativos.

ANALITICA - INTEGRATOR

REFERENCIAS / EXPERIENCIA

Proyecto SENSOR – ECOPETROL:

– Integración de hojas de MS-Excel para el sistema de información volumétrica (SIV) via XMLoader (Herramienta predecesora)

• Reservas de hidrocarburos• Inventarios y movimientos de las refinerías de

– Orito– Apiay

• Oleoducto Trans Andino (OTA)• Planeación de transporte de crudos y refinados• Sistema de cálculo de propiedad de crudos y gas.• Sistema de precios de transferencia• Ordenes de compra de crudos• Distribución de Gas Opón / El Centro.• Curvas de producción básica/incremental en campos• Regímenes de regalías

– Sistema de control de integridad de información volumétrica.• Sistema operativo de Negocio Solución de informacion Volumétrica• Solución de informacion volumétrica SAP/R3